Add check to tests

This commit is contained in:
Alex Hyett 2023-09-27 14:05:58 +01:00
parent 03aedd9564
commit 4ac39a2730
4 changed files with 12 additions and 8 deletions

View file

@ -1,5 +1,5 @@
import http from 'k6/http'; import http from 'k6/http';
import { sleep } from 'k6'; import { sleep, check } from 'k6';
import { SharedArray } from 'k6/data'; import { SharedArray } from 'k6/data';
var hostname = __ENV.HOSTNAME; var hostname = __ENV.HOSTNAME;
@ -33,6 +33,7 @@ const dates = new SharedArray('dates', function () {
export default () => { export default () => {
const randomDate = dates[Math.floor(Math.random() * dates.length)]; const randomDate = dates[Math.floor(Math.random() * dates.length)];
http.get(`http://${hostname}/age/${randomDate}`); const res = http.get(`http://${hostname}/age/${randomDate}`);
check(res, { '200': (r) => r.status === 200 });
sleep(1); sleep(1);
}; };

View file

@ -1,5 +1,5 @@
import http from 'k6/http'; import http from 'k6/http';
import { sleep } from 'k6'; import { sleep, check } from 'k6';
import { SharedArray } from 'k6/data'; import { SharedArray } from 'k6/data';
var hostname = __ENV.HOSTNAME; var hostname = __ENV.HOSTNAME;
@ -30,6 +30,7 @@ const dates = new SharedArray('dates', function () {
export default () => { export default () => {
const randomDate = dates[Math.floor(Math.random() * dates.length)]; const randomDate = dates[Math.floor(Math.random() * dates.length)];
http.get(`http://${hostname}/age/${randomDate}`); const res = http.get(`http://${hostname}/age/${randomDate}`);
check(res, { '200': (r) => r.status === 200 });
sleep(1); sleep(1);
}; };

View file

@ -1,5 +1,5 @@
import http from 'k6/http'; import http from 'k6/http';
import { sleep } from 'k6'; import { sleep, check } from 'k6';
import { SharedArray } from 'k6/data'; import { SharedArray } from 'k6/data';
var hostname = __ENV.HOSTNAME; var hostname = __ENV.HOSTNAME;
@ -34,6 +34,7 @@ const dates = new SharedArray('dates', function () {
export default () => { export default () => {
const randomDate = dates[Math.floor(Math.random() * dates.length)]; const randomDate = dates[Math.floor(Math.random() * dates.length)];
http.get(`http://${hostname}/age/${randomDate}`); const res = http.get(`http://${hostname}/age/${randomDate}`);
check(res, { '200': (r) => r.status === 200 });
sleep(1); sleep(1);
}; };

View file

@ -1,5 +1,5 @@
import http from 'k6/http'; import http from 'k6/http';
import { sleep } from 'k6'; import { sleep, check } from 'k6';
import { SharedArray } from 'k6/data'; import { SharedArray } from 'k6/data';
var hostname = __ENV.HOSTNAME; var hostname = __ENV.HOSTNAME;
@ -34,6 +34,7 @@ const dates = new SharedArray('dates', function () {
export default () => { export default () => {
const randomDate = dates[Math.floor(Math.random() * dates.length)]; const randomDate = dates[Math.floor(Math.random() * dates.length)];
http.get(`http://${hostname}/age/${randomDate}`); const res = http.get(`http://${hostname}/age/${randomDate}`);
check(res, { '200': (r) => r.status === 200 });
sleep(1); sleep(1);
}; };